A nurse who went missing after taking part in a medical trial for a treatment for malaria has turned up safe and well in the Netherlands.

Matthew Lloyd, 35, above, from Southampton, in Hampshire, was reported missing when he failed to attend an appointment in Oxford on October 7, when he was due to receive drugs in connection with the trial.

Mr Lloyd, who police said could die if he did not receive urgent medication, is being assessed in a Dutch hospital, a Hampshire Police spokesman said yesterday.
